About Frodo with Cooking Corner polybag
Frodo with Cooking Corner polybag (30210-1) is a LEGO Lord of the Rings set released in 2012, currently averaging $16.30 used on BrickLink. It comes with 1 minifigure worth a combined $5.74. The set has retired from retail, so secondary market is the only option.

How much is LEGO Frodo with Cooking Corner polybag (30210-1) worth?
Frodo with Cooking Corner polybag sells for an average of $16.30 used and $17.88 new/sealed on BrickLink based on 6 months of completed sales. As a retired set, prices tend to hold steady or appreciate over time, especially for complete sets with original packaging. Actual prices vary with completeness — missing minifigures or key parts will lower the value.
What minifigures come in LEGO set 30210-1?
This set includes 1 minifigure: Frodo Baggins - Sand Green Shirt ($5.74). The minifigures have a combined BrickLink value of $5.74. Each figure is linked above with individual pricing if you're looking to buy or sell specific characters.
